    Understanding the Basics of AI

    So, what exactly is artificial intelligence? At its core, AI is about creating machines that can perform tasks that typically require human intelligence. This includes things like learning, problem-solving, decision-making, and even understanding natural language. Think of it as teaching computers to think and act like humans – pretty cool, right?

    AI isn't a monolith; it comes in different forms, each with its own capabilities and applications:

    • Narrow or Weak AI: This type of AI is designed to perform a specific task. Examples include spam filters, recommendation systems, and virtual assistants like Siri or Alexa. These systems excel at their designated jobs, but they don't possess general intelligence.
    • General or Strong AI: This is the kind of AI you see in movies – machines that can perform any intellectual task that a human being can. We're not quite there yet, but researchers are working towards this goal. AGI would have the ability to learn, understand, and apply knowledge across a wide range of domains.
    • Super AI: This is a hypothetical level of AI that surpasses human intelligence in every aspect. It's more science fiction than reality at this point, but it raises interesting questions about the future of AI and its potential impact on society.

    To achieve these different levels of AI, various techniques are employed. Machine learning, a subset of AI, is a big one. It involves training algorithms on vast amounts of data so they can learn patterns and make predictions without being explicitly programmed. Deep learning, a further subset of machine learning, uses artificial neural networks with multiple layers to analyze data in a more sophisticated way. This is what powers many of the advanced AI applications we see today, like image recognition and natural language processing.

    AI also relies on other techniques like natural language processing (NLP), which enables computers to understand and generate human language; computer vision, which allows machines to "see" and interpret images; and robotics, which combines AI with physical robots to automate tasks. All of these components work together to create intelligent systems that can interact with the world in meaningful ways.

    The rise of AI is fueled by several factors, including the increasing availability of data, the development of more powerful computing hardware, and advancements in AI algorithms. As these trends continue, we can expect AI to become even more prevalent and transformative in the years to come.

    AI in Our Daily Lives

    You might be thinking, "Okay, that's interesting, but how does AI actually affect me?" Well, the truth is, AI is already deeply woven into the fabric of our daily lives, often in ways we don't even realize. From the moment you wake up to the time you go to bed, AI is working behind the scenes to make your life easier, more efficient, and more enjoyable.

    Here are just a few examples of how AI is used in everyday scenarios:

    • Smart Devices: Think about your smartphone. It uses AI for facial recognition, voice search, and predictive text. Smart home devices like Amazon Echo and Google Home rely on AI to understand your voice commands and control your lights, music, and other appliances.
    • Social Media: Social media platforms use AI to personalize your news feed, recommend content you might like, and target you with relevant ads. AI algorithms analyze your behavior and preferences to create a customized experience.
    • E-commerce: When you shop online, AI powers recommendation engines that suggest products you might be interested in based on your browsing history and past purchases. AI is also used to detect fraud and prevent unauthorized transactions.
    • Transportation: AI is transforming the way we travel. Self-driving cars are becoming a reality, thanks to AI-powered computer vision and machine learning algorithms. AI is also used to optimize traffic flow, predict arrival times, and improve the efficiency of public transportation systems.
    • Healthcare: AI is revolutionizing healthcare by helping doctors diagnose diseases earlier and more accurately, personalize treatment plans, and develop new drugs. AI-powered robots are even being used to assist in surgeries.
    • Entertainment: Streaming services like Netflix and Spotify use AI to recommend movies, TV shows, and music that you'll love. AI is also being used to create new forms of entertainment, like AI-generated art and music.

    These are just a few examples, and the list is growing every day. As AI technology continues to evolve, we can expect to see even more innovative applications emerge in the future. From personalized education to smarter cities, the possibilities are endless.

    Why Everyone Needs to Understand AI

    Okay, so AI is everywhere. But why is it important for everyone to understand it? Why should you care, even if you're not a tech expert?

    The answer is simple: AI is going to have a profound impact on our society, our economy, and our future. It's not just a technological trend; it's a fundamental shift that will reshape the world as we know it. And if we want to navigate this new world successfully, we need to be informed and engaged.

    Here are a few key reasons why everyone should strive to understand AI:

    • Career Opportunities: AI is creating new jobs and transforming existing ones. Even if you're not a data scientist or a software engineer, understanding AI can give you a competitive edge in your field. Whether you're in marketing, finance, or healthcare, AI is likely to play an increasingly important role in your work.
    • Informed Decision-Making: As AI becomes more integrated into our lives, it's crucial to understand its potential biases and limitations. AI algorithms are trained on data, and if that data reflects existing inequalities, the AI system may perpetuate those biases. By understanding how AI works, we can make more informed decisions about its use and advocate for fairer and more equitable outcomes.
    • Ethical Considerations: AI raises a number of ethical questions, such as how to ensure that AI systems are used responsibly and that they don't infringe on our privacy or autonomy. We need to have a public conversation about these issues and develop ethical guidelines for AI development and deployment.
    • Economic Impact: AI has the potential to boost productivity, create new industries, and drive economic growth. But it also poses challenges, such as the potential displacement of workers due to automation. We need to prepare for these changes and ensure that the benefits of AI are shared broadly.
    • Civic Engagement: As AI becomes more prevalent, it's important for citizens to be informed about its implications and to participate in the policy debates surrounding its use. We need to ensure that AI is used in a way that aligns with our values and promotes the common good.

    In short, understanding AI is not just for tech experts anymore. It's a fundamental skill for navigating the 21st century. By becoming more informed about AI, we can empower ourselves to make better decisions, shape the future, and ensure that AI is used for the benefit of all.

    The Future of AI: Opportunities and Challenges

    Looking ahead, the future of AI is full of both exciting opportunities and potential challenges. As AI technology continues to advance, we can expect to see even more transformative applications emerge across a wide range of industries.

    On the opportunity side, AI has the potential to:

    • Solve some of the world's most pressing problems: From climate change to disease outbreaks, AI can help us find solutions to complex challenges that have eluded us for decades.
    • Create new industries and jobs: AI is not just automating existing jobs; it's also creating entirely new industries and job categories that we can't even imagine today.
    • Improve our quality of life: AI can help us live healthier, more productive, and more fulfilling lives by automating mundane tasks, personalizing experiences, and providing us with new insights and knowledge.

    However, we also need to be aware of the potential challenges that AI poses:

    • Bias and Discrimination: AI algorithms can perpetuate existing biases if they are trained on biased data. We need to ensure that AI systems are fair, equitable, and transparent.
    • Job Displacement: As AI automates more tasks, some workers may be displaced. We need to invest in education and training programs to help workers adapt to the changing job market.
    • Privacy and Security: AI systems often collect and analyze vast amounts of data, raising concerns about privacy and security. We need to develop robust safeguards to protect our personal information.
    • Autonomous Weapons: The development of autonomous weapons raises ethical and security concerns. We need to have a global conversation about the responsible use of AI in military applications.

    To navigate these challenges successfully, we need to adopt a proactive and collaborative approach. This includes investing in AI research, developing ethical guidelines, promoting education and training, and fostering public dialogue.

    Getting Started with AI

    Feeling inspired and ready to dive into the world of AI? Awesome! You don't need to be a coding whiz to start learning about AI and experimenting with its capabilities. There are plenty of resources available for beginners, regardless of your technical background.

    Here are a few ways to get started with AI:

    • Online Courses: Platforms like Coursera, edX, and Udacity offer a wide range of AI courses, from introductory tutorials to advanced deep learning programs. Many of these courses are free or offer financial aid.
    • Books and Articles: There are countless books and articles on AI, covering everything from the basics to the latest research. Look for resources that are tailored to your level of knowledge and interests.
    • Online Communities: Join online communities like Reddit's r/MachineLearning or Stack Overflow to connect with other AI enthusiasts, ask questions, and share your experiences.
    • Open-Source Tools: Experiment with open-source AI tools and frameworks like TensorFlow, PyTorch, and scikit-learn. These tools are free to use and offer a wealth of documentation and examples.
    • Hands-On Projects: The best way to learn about AI is by doing. Try building your own AI projects, such as a simple image classifier or a chatbot. There are plenty of tutorials and resources available online to guide you.
